How to fill out education of homeless children?

01
Identify and assess the educational needs of homeless children: Start by identifying homeless children in your community and assessing their specific educational needs. This can be done through collaboration with local homeless shelters, nonprofit organizations, or outreach initiatives.
02
Ensure enrollment in school: It is crucial to ensure that homeless children are enrolled in school. Collaborate with local school districts and education officials to facilitate the enrollment process for homeless children. This may involve providing necessary documentation or advocating for their immediate enrollment.
03
Provide transportation assistance: Homeless children may face challenges in getting to school regularly. Explore options for providing transportation assistance, such as collaborating with local transportation services, providing bus passes, or arranging carpooling systems to ensure that homeless children can attend school consistently.
04
Secure stable housing and address basic needs: As stable housing is a key factor in supporting a child's education, collaborate with local agencies and organizations to provide assistance in securing stable housing for homeless children and their families. Addressing their basic needs, such as food, clothing, and healthcare, is also essential for their well-being and educational success.
05
Offer academic support services: Homeless children might require additional academic support due to potential disruptions in their education. Establish programs or partnerships to provide tutoring, mentoring, or after-school resources to help them catch up academically and succeed in their studies.
06
Address social and emotional needs: Homeless children often face social and emotional challenges that can impact their educational experience. Collaborate with counselors, social workers, or other support services to provide counseling, mentoring, or other interventions to address their social and emotional well-being.
